Best places to visit during your Kenya honeymoon safari.
It goes without saying that Masai Mara national Reserve in Kenya is the most famous location for honeymoon safaris. A honeymoon in Kenya’s Maasai Mara is truly unforgettable. Among the most well-known safari locations worldwide is Maasai Mara. Every year, from July to October, the Great Wildebeest Migration takes place in Maasai Mara. If you are thinking of going to Kenya for your honeymoon, scheduling your trip to take place during the migration will be quite beneficial to you.

What to expect during your honeymoon in Kenya

The majority of lodging establishments in Kenya offer meals to their visitors, which frequently include breakfast, which is served early each morning before visitors depart to begin their days. Depending on the location you’re staying in, dinners are typically three courses, but you may enjoy opulent lunches wherever you go.

Couples, whether on a honeymoon or not, can always request romantic, private dinners or lunches. For instance, you can eat dinner in private on your balcony or in your room. Additionally, you can eat lunch behind a tree in the bushes if you are in a wilderness.

Best honeymoon Destinations in Kenya.
Kenya’s capital city is called Nairobi City. It is home to several historical monuments, museums that will provide you with a thorough understanding of the political and cultural past of the nation, stunning skyscrapers, lovely hotels, excellent dining options, and an exciting nightlife.

Maasai Mara Game Reserve: this is home to the greatest number of wild animals especially the big mammals in the whole of Kenya. Approximately two million animals participate in the annual wildebeest migration, which takes place every year on the plains of the Maasai Mara.
The second-highest mountain in Africa is called Mount Kenya. Go on a romantic mountaineering journey with your significant other and relish the incredible challenge of reaching the snow-capped summit of Mount Kenya.

Lewa Wildlife Conservancy: A trip to Lewa is really an excellent honeymoon favorable in Kenya since it is such an amazing wildlife wonderland. Numerous black and white rhinos, enormous herds of elephants, several antelope species, such as Sitatungas, golden zebras, giraffes, and schools of hippos are all to be expected.

Amboseli National Park: This national park is a great place to come if you enjoy the outdoors. Many different species can be found in the park, including buffaloes, zebras, warthogs, hyenas, elephants, wildebeests, rhinos, leopards, cheetahs, and occasionally Maasai giraffes.

Diani Beach is regarded as one of the best honeymoon dream locations because it offers a variety of experiences to suit the needs of various visitors, from white sand beaches for those who just want to stroll and relax by the beach to really clear waters for those who are interested in water spots.
